WebFeb 10, 2024 · Prior to initial use, prime pump 6 times (or until fine spray appears); repeat priming if product not used for ≥7 days. Spray in nostril(s); avoid spraying in eyes or mouth. Nasal applicator and dust cap may be washed in warm water and dry thoroughly. Qnasl: Spray in nostril(s); avoid spraying in eyes or mouth. WebShake the container well before each use. Follow the instructions to properly prime the spray pump.To use the spray, first remove the safety clip and plastic cap. Close one nostril by pressing it with your finger. Tilt your head slightly forward and, keeping the bottle upright, carefully insert the nasal applicator into the other nostril.
